Queering the Trans: Gender and sexuality binaries in Icelandic Trans, Queer, and Feminist communities ...

Activists in feminist, queer, and trans movements share in common a critique of the existing gender order. Yet activists may have different understandings of what is wrong with existing gender arrangements, and different understandings of what might be required to establish greater social equality....
